Abstract

The utility model relates to a liquid sampling device, in particular to a sewage sampling valve. The sewage sampling valve comprises a valve body. The upper end of the valve body is connected with a sample feeding pipe and a sample outlet pipe, and a liquid outlet is arranged at the lower end of the valve body. A valve core is sleeved inside the valve body, a control coil is arranged outside the valve body, the control coil is connected with a controller, the valve core is a plastic-sealing iron core, and three supporting points are evenly distributed on the inner wall of the valve body on the lower portion of the valve core. The sewage sampling valve has the advantages that a plastic-sealing iron core structure replaces a traditional glass-sealing iron core structure to be used as the valve core, so that a grinding process is removed, manufacturing is simple, cost is low, and the effects of sealing and throttling are excellent.

Description

Sewage sampling valve
Technical field
The utility model relates to a kind of liquid sampler, particularly a kind of sewage sampling valve.
Background technique
In prior art, the electromagnetic valve core of sewage sampling valve adopts the structure of glass capsulation iron core more, in order to strengthen the sealing between spool and valve body, its surface of contact pair frosted structures that adopt more, but frosting technology is a kind of processing technology that bothers very much in producing, and is strict, complex procedures, cost is higher, and sealing and restriction effect not good enough.
Summary of the invention
The utility model is for solving the deficiency in the above-mentioned background technology, a kind of Novel sewage sampling valve is provided, by adopting the plastic seal core structure to substitute traditional glass capsulation core structure as spool, technique is more simple, cost is lower, sealing effect is better, throttling action is more outstanding thereby make.
For achieving the above object, the technical solution adopted in the utility model is:
Sewage sampling valve comprises valve body, and the upper end of valve body is connected with sample feeding pipe and goes out the sample pipe, the lower end is provided with liquid outlet, valve inner cover cartridge spool, and there is control coil the outside of valve body, control coil connects controller, and spool is the plastic seal iron core, and the valve interior wall of spool bottom is evenly equipped with three fulcrums.
Spool is polytetrafluoroethylplastic plastic sealing iron core.
Compared with prior art, the beneficial effects of the utility model are to adopt the plastic seal core structure to substitute traditional glass capsulation core structure as spool, thereby saved frosting technology, make that processing is more simple, cost is lower, and sealing and restriction effect more outstanding.
Description of drawings
Fig. 1 is the utility model structural representation
Embodiment
The utility model is described in further detail below in conjunction with accompanying drawing and preferred embodiment:
Sewage sampling valve, comprise valve body 1, the upper end of valve body 1 is connected with sample feeding pipe 2 and goes out sample pipe 3, the lower end is provided with liquid outlet 4, valve body 1 internal sleeve cartridge spool 5, there is control coil the outside of valve body 1, and control coil connects controller, spool 5 is polytetrafluoroethylplastic plastic sealing iron core, and valve body 1 inner wall even distribution of spool 5 bottoms has three fulcrums 6.
